How to convert a letter to a specified letter?

2 New Member
I'm using Turbo C++ and I'm trying to convert letters to specified letters using single-dimension arrays.

Lets say I enter the name MATT into the program and it'll cipher the name to HYKR. How can I achieve this?

A char is just an 8-bit integer. You can add, subtract, divide and multiply chars. Just get the correct value in the variable. If it's to be displayeable, consult your ASCII table for the range of alphanumerics.

Expand|Select|Wrap|Line Numbers
  1. char data = 'M''
  2.         data++;         //it's now an N
